Command Analysis

Borussia Dortmund were the favourites for the second-line finish in Group G before the start of the competition, and so far this is exactly where they sit. Edin Terzic's charges confidently defeated Copenhagen (3:0) in the first game and put up a good fight against Manchester City in England (1:2). Last week, the German team crushed Sevilla (4:1).
Borussia are in 4th place in the Bundesliga table, four points behind the current leader Union Berlin. In the previous match, Terzic's side got a hard-fought draw against Bayern Munich (2:2) - they were two goals down after 53 minutes of football, but managed to bounce back and level the score.

Sevilla have endured a terrible season so far. Many key players left the club in the summer transfet window, and that reflected on the team's results at the start of the season. At the moment, Sevilla are in 18th place in the La Liga standings with only 6 points.
In the Champions League, the Red-and-Whites suffered a crushing (0:4) defeat to Manchester City and were held to a goalless draw by Copenhagen in Denmark. Julen Lopetegui was fired after Sevilla lost to Borussia Dortmund (1:4) last week, and Jorge Sampaoli took over as coach. Under his management, Sevilla drew against Athletic (1:1) at home.
